Specifications of CY14E256LA-SZ25XIT

Format - Memory
RAM
Memory Type
NVSRAM (Non-Volatile SRAM)
Memory Size
256K (32K x 8)
Speed
25ns
Interface
Parallel
Voltage - Supply
4.5 V ~ 5.5 V
Operating Temperature
-40°C ~ 85°C
Package / Case
32-SOIC (7.5mm Width)
Lead Free Status / RoHS Status
Lead free / RoHS Compliant

Software Sequence
The CY14E256LA has been designed to be compatible with
the CY14E256L/STK14C88 in the software sequence
modes. Hence, the same Software STORE and RECALL
address sequences in CY14E256L/STK14C88 works in
CY14E256LA, requiring no firmware change.
